Fall into clean streets! Fall street sweeping to begin Tuesday, October 15

October 10, 2024 - 10:00am

TC24-10448
October 10, 2024 - 10:00 am

The City of Saskatoon is prepared for the annual Fall Street Sweeping program, an important initiative to keep streets clean and reduce the risk of spring flooding. 

From October 15 to October 24, street sweeping crews will be clearing fallen leaves from some of Saskatoon’s leafiest neighborhoods, which includes Buena Vista, Caswell Hill, City Park, Exhibition, Holiday Park, King George, Mayfair, Nutana, Riversdale and Varsity View. Residents can find their scheduled sweep day by visiting saskatoon.ca/sweep. 

"Fallen leaves can cause issues by blocking catch basins and storm drains, which can lead to flooding when the snow melts in spring," says Cam LeClaire, Roadways Manager. "This preventative work not only protects city infrastructure but also improves quality of life for residents." 

Temporary parking restrictions will be in place and vehicles may be ticketed or towed if necessary. 

How You Can Help: 

  • Clear leaves from the sidewalk and boulevard next to your property but avoid pushing leaves into the street, as large piles can slow down the sweepers. 

  • Dispose of loose leaves in your green cart or drop them off at a compost depot. Bagged leaves can be placed in your black cart. 

  • Watch for the yellow No Parking signs and move your vehicle by 7:00 a.m. on your scheduled sweep day. If your vehicle is towed, you can use the Find My Vehicle! tool or call our Customer Care Centre at 306-975-2476. 

Service Alerts will be issued if changes to the schedule are necessary due to weather or other factors. For more details, visit saskatoon.ca/sweep.

2024 Civic Election: how the order of candidate names on the ballot will be determined

October 8, 2024 - 5:30am

CK24-10452
October 8, 2024 - 5:30 am

Dedicated planning for the 2024 Civic Election to be held November 13, 2024, continues. This fall, eligible voters will cast their ballot for Saskatoon’s local government leadership for the next four-year term: mayor, city councillors and school board trustees for the Public and Catholic School Boards.

Ever wonder how the order of candidate names is determined on a ballot when there are several candidates running for one office or in the same ward?

For the 2024 Civic Election, Elections Saskatoon, in accordance with Bylaw No. 8191, The Election Bylaw, 2012, subsection 7.1(3), for where there are (5) five or more candidates (for a certain office), will arrange the names of candidates on a ballot randomly in accordance with subsection 91 (2) of The Local Government Election Act.  If there are fewer than five candidates for a certain office, then the names will be arranged alphabetically.

Save the date! All candidates, members of the voting public and media are invited to observe the random ballot name draw to be held in Council Chamber at City Hall on Wednesday, October 9, 2024. The event will start at 5 p.m.

If, after the draw, a candidate withdraws their nomination by 4 p.m. on October 10, 2024, their name will be removed. If the withdrawal of nomination causes there to be fewer than five candidates, their names will be listed on the ballot in alphabetical order.

Get ready to make your voting experience faster: Register for the Voters List before October 22

Elections Saskatoon will use a Voters List for this fall’s civic election for the first time since 1988. The Voters List is a list of eligible, registered voters in Saskatoon. The Voters List makes it easier to verify a voter’s identity, and its use ensures only eligible voters vote once. 

Pre-register for the Voters List to help make your voting experience faster and more efficient when you go to vote, either at early voting opportunities or on Election Day. We encourage all eligible voters to get ready to vote by registering early, here’s how:

Go Online: Visit saskatoon.ca/voterlookup before October 22, 2024, to check, update or add your information to the Voters List:

  • Review your information, make sure it’s correct.
  • Have you moved? Update your address.
  • Just turned 18 yrs.? Register to vote for the first time. Congratulations!
  • Changed your name? Update your voter information.

You can also have your information on the Voters List updated or added via these options:

  • email elections@saskatoon.ca
  • phone the Elections Saskatoon Office 306-657-VOTE (8683)
  • in-person at Elections Saskatoon Office at 200-145 1st Ave North. 

Besides making sure you’re registered, and your voter information is correct, it’s important that all voters, regardless of having children in the school system, indicate (or update) the school division you support. This is to ensure you receive the correct ballot when you go to vote.

Note: Only voters who own assessable property, but do not reside in Saskatoon, will select No School Support when they register for the Voters List. 

Remember, voters: if you don’t get a chance to check, confirm or update the Voters List before October 22, 2024, via your available options (online, email, phone, or in person) - not to worry! All eligible voters will be able to register at the voting location they attend either at an early voting opportunity or on Election Day.

Bike box installed on Wiggins Avenue at College Drive

October 1, 2024 - 10:00am

TC24-10407
October 1, 2024 - 10:00 am

The City of Saskatoon has installed a new bike box on Wiggins Avenue at the intersection of College Drive and a painted bike lane for Wiggins Avenue northbound between Elliot Street and College Drive as part of an ongoing commitment to improving road safety for all users.  

The bike box is intended to provide greater visibility and reduce conflict points between vehicles and cyclists. A bike box is designed to provide cyclists with a designated space at the front of the traffic queue. A "no right turn on red" restriction for northbound drivers making a right turn onto College Drive has also been installed.  

A reduced speed limit of 30 km/h on Wiggins Avenue from 50 metres south of Elliot Street to College Drive will take effect on September 30, 2024. New speed limit signage has been installed to inform drivers of the speed limit changes for this block.

City to lower flags in recognition of Police & Peace Officers’ National Memorial Day

September 27, 2024 - 4:00pm

ST24-10415
September 27, 2024 - 4:00 pm

Police and Peace Officers’ National Memorial Day is Sunday, September 29, 2024.  In recognition, flags at all City of Saskatoon facilities will fly at half-mast for the day.

Police and Peace Officers’ National Memorial Day is recognized every year in Canada on the last Sunday in September. The day pays tribute to the hard work, dedication and sacrifice police and peace officers have made toward the safety of Canadians.

Flags are flown at half-mast to honour police and peace officers killed in the line of duty. Memorial services will also take place in communities across the country.

Council approves funding for 492 new affordable housing units

September 27, 2024 - 3:30pm

CY24-10426
September 27, 2024 - 3:30 pm

City Council unanimously approved $13,284,000 for Affordable Housing Incentives to support 18 projects aimed at developing 492 new affordable rental units in Saskatoon. The capital grants were endorsed at Council’s Regular Business Meeting on September 25. The grants are made possible through the Housing Accelerator Fund (HAF). Additionally, 17 of the projects received Council approval for a five-year incremental tax abatement, estimated at $3,028,155.15.

"Saskatoon is facing an affordability crisis,” says Mayor Charlie Clark. “These incentives will help provide housing to families, seniors, and students who are being priced out of the current housing market. Affordable housing units keep people safely housed and off the streets in our city, yet they continue to be a gap in the housing continuum. It is our priority to provide housing options for people of all income levels and abilities in Saskatoon."

Affordable Housing Incentives (2024) Overview

The Affordable Housing Incentives Call for Proposals was issued on June 5, 2024, and remained open until July 5, 2024. This initiative invited applicants proposing the construction of new affordable rental units to apply for capital grants of up to $27,000 per unit, along with the opportunity to secure a five-year incremental tax abatement. The program attracted significant interest, with a total of 25 applications submitted.

Eligible projects must involve the construction of new affordable rental units, which may include units within mixed-market developments. Affordable housing is defined as housing for low-income households, with incomes at or below the Saskatchewan Household Income Maximums, while spending no more than 30 percent of their income on housing or set at the maximum funding available under the shelter benefit.

“It’s very important; these incentives, as they will also help us leverage more funding from CMHC and other funders and address the massive need as reflected on our waiting list and in Saskatoon in general,” says Angela Bishop of Camponi Housing Corporation. “In the spirit of reconciliation, kinship and unity we can all be architects of a stronger, inclusive and more vibrant Saskatoon.”

To qualify for funding, applicants were required to have a minimum of five years of experience in the affordable housing sector or residential development. Additionally, successful projects must secure a building permit no later than December 27, 2026, to meet the timelines set by the Housing Accelerator Fund agreement and the units must remain affordable for at least 20 years.

The International Council of Aging designated September 30 to October 6 as Active Aging Week – a time to celebrate aging and the benefits of active living at any age.

Active Aging Week challenges society’s expectations of aging by showing that regardless of age or health conditions, adults over 50 can live life to the fullest.

“The City of Saskatoon’s Recreation & Community Development Department is committed to promoting Active Aging through a variety of drop-in and registered programs available at our Leisure Centres,” says Andrew Roberts, Director of Recreation & Community Development. “Our Fit Over 50 programs are specifically designed to guide and encourage physical activity for individuals aged 50 +”.

30 km/h speed limit take effect on Dudley Street bikeway

September 27, 2024 - 10:00am

TC24-10399
September 27, 2024 - 10:00 am

A 30 kilometre per hour (km/h) speed limit on the Dudley Street neighbourhood bikeway between Avenue P and Spadina Crescent will be in effect starting Monday September 30. The change is part of the City of Saskatoon’s ongoing commitment to improving road safety for all users. This marks the third neighbourhood bikeway to have a reduced speed limit implemented this year. It follows 23rd Street West and 14th Street East. 

The 30 km/h speed limit on Dudley Street helps create a safer, more comfortable environment for cyclists of all levels, supporting the City’s efforts to promote active transportation. New speed limit signage has been installed to inform drivers of the speed limit changes for this bikeway. 

The reduced speed limits on this key bikeway align with the policy approved by City Council in December 2023. The Dudley Street bikeway links the Meewasin Trail with surrounding residential neighborhoods, Gordie Howe sports complex and employment areas.
